One way to ensure a smooth and peaceful traveling experience is to jot down an international travel abroad checklist of all the things you need to iron out. Obviously, on top of the list of things to do before travelling overseas is to locate your copyright. It is impossible to leave the country without your copyright, so checking that you have a valid copyright needs to always be the very first step to planning your travels. One of the most significant errors that people make is not understanding that their copyright expires in 6 months; while it can vary relying on where you are travelling to, the basic consensus is that nations will not accept your copyright if there is just six months of validity left until its expiration.
